patients with peripheral arterial disease are recommended to perform all exercise forms including elliptical type. electromagnetic treatment addition to exercise may increase benefits of this exercise
patients (40 elderly) with peripheral arterial disease who take their medications will be divided to older patients group that receive one hour elliptical exercise (n=20 patients, exercise will be applied 3 times per the week for eight week) and a group (n=20) that receive 3 sessions per weeks of 8-week electromagnetic one-hour therapy and one hour elliptical exercise (exercise will be applied 3 times per the week for eight week)

RECRUITINGankle brachial index
it is an vascular index used in assessment of peripheral arterial disease progression
Time frame: It will be measured after 8 weeks
posterior tibial artery diameter
increase in vascular diameter of vessel denotes improved arterial disease
Time frame: It will be measured after 8 weeks
claudication pain time
the starting onset time of pain appearance during treadmill test
Time frame: It will be measured after 8 weeks
claudication pain distance
the distance at which onset of pain appeared during treadmill test
Time frame: It will be measured after 8 weeks
Modified walking impairment questionnaire
it assess degree of walking impairment in vascular disease patients
Time frame: It will be measured after 8 weeks
six minute walking test (pain free distance)
pain free distance walked during six minute walking test will be calculated
Time frame: It will be measured after 8 weeks
six minute walking test (total walked distance)
total distance walked during six minute walking test will be calculated
Time frame: it will be measured after 8 weeks
intermittent claudication questionnaire
it will assess health-related quality of life concerning the issue of intermittent claudication
